Early Life
Gustavo Petro was born on April 19, 1960, in Ciénaga de Oro, Córdoba, Colombia, to Gustavo Petro Sierra and Clara Urrego. Growing up in a modest family, he was influenced by the social inequalities in Colombia, which shaped his early political consciousness. At age 17, he joined the M-19 guerrilla movement, a leftist group advocating for social justice, marking the beginning of his activist journey.
Education
Petro studied economics at the Universidad Externado de Colombia and later pursued graduate studies at the Pontifical Xavierian University. He also attended the University of Louvain in Belgium, where he deepened his understanding of economic and social issues, which later influenced his political ideology.
Career
Petro’s career began with his involvement in the M-19 guerrilla movement, where he was active from 1977 until the group’s demobilization in 1990. He transitioned to mainstream politics, serving as a congressman in the 1990s, a senator from 2006 to 2010, and mayor of Bogotá from 2012 to 2015. His presidency, starting in 2022, focuses on social justice, environmental policies, and economic reform.
